The search for an "FB profile picture viewer" is a journey down a rabbit hole filled with security risks, scams, and misinformation. While legitimate browser extensions may help fetch public profile pictures in higher resolution, none can bypass Facebook's core privacy settings to show you content from locked or private accounts.
While some extensions simply provide a convenient way to fetch a public image's higher resolution, the vast majority of apps and websites promoting themselves as "profile viewers" are dangerous. The cybersecurity community is unanimous on this point: there is that can show you private content that Facebook's own privacy settings block.
